技术文摘
.NET DB2程序建立的注意方法
.NET DB2程序建立的注意方法
在.NET开发中,与DB2数据库建立程序连接并进行交互是常见的需求。要确保程序的高效性、稳定性和安全性,在建立.NET DB2程序时,需要注意以下几个关键方法。
确保正确安装和配置DB2驱动程序。DB2驱动是.NET程序与DB2数据库通信的桥梁。在安装过程中,要严格按照DB2官方文档的指引进行操作,确保驱动版本与.NET框架版本以及DB2数据库版本兼容。安装完成后,还需要在项目中正确引用驱动程序,这一步是建立连接的基础。
连接字符串的配置至关重要。连接字符串包含了连接数据库所需的各种信息,如数据库服务器地址、端口号、数据库名称、用户名和密码等。在编写连接字符串时,要确保信息的准确性。为了提高安全性,建议不要在代码中硬编码敏感信息,如密码,可以通过配置文件或加密存储的方式来获取。
在编写数据库操作代码时,要遵循良好的编程规范。例如,使用参数化查询来防止SQL注入攻击。参数化查询将用户输入作为参数传递给SQL语句,而不是直接嵌入到语句中,这样可以有效避免恶意用户通过构造特殊的SQL语句来获取或篡改数据。
另外,要注意错误处理和异常捕获。在与数据库交互过程中,可能会出现各种错误,如连接失败、查询超时等。通过合理的错误处理机制,可以及时发现并解决问题,提高程序的健壮性。例如,在执行数据库操作时,使用try-catch语句来捕获可能出现的异常,并根据异常类型进行相应的处理。
性能优化也是需要考虑的重要方面。避免在循环中频繁地打开和关闭数据库连接,可以使用连接池来提高连接的复用率。同时,优化SQL语句的编写,减少不必要的查询和数据传输,提高数据库操作的效率。
建立.NET DB2程序需要关注多个方面,从驱动安装到代码编写,再到性能优化,每个环节都不容忽视。只有严格遵循相关的注意方法,才能开发出高质量的.NET DB2程序。
- 前端必知的 4 款 Chrome 插件
- 大二学生让本科作业登上 Nature 子刊 突破量子计算近 20 年纠错码难题
- 3.6 万 Star 开源跨平台文件同步工具
- @Transactional 注解失效的三种场景与解决之道
- 从对 Kubernetes 集群网络懵圈到熟悉,一篇搞定
- 透彻了解 equals() 、 == 与 hashCode() 就在今日
- 计数排序真的无足轻重吗
- 开发者怎样借助有效工具开启 Kubernetes 之旅
- Netfilter 与 Iptables 的实现之 Netfilter 实现
- CSS :Where 和 :Is 伪类函数的介绍
- 深度把控 Java Stream 流操作,提升代码档次!
- Java 中优雅分割 String 字符串的方法
- C# 索引器 一文带你全知晓
- 2021 年,仅会一种 CSS 实现三角形的方式可还行?
- 四个超棒的 Veu 路由过渡动效及众多动效介绍